News and Information

PAJHWOK
17 Jun 2021
  Pakistan;   Afghanistan
Reuters
14 Jun 2021
  Norway
Xinhuanet
13 Jun 2021
  Afghanistan;   People's Republic of China
Forbes
13 Jun 2021
  Austria;   Canada;   Denmark;   France;   Germany;   Ireland;   Italy;   Japan;   Luxembourg;   Netherlands;   Norway;   Portugal;   Spain;   Switzerland